Home » St. Francis Wood & West Portal (San Francisco, CA) restaurants

Spiazzo Caffe

Features: Cafes, Italian, Pasta

id: spi33wport

See similar restaurants in & around St. Francis Wood & West Portal (San Francisco, California): Cafes | Italian | Pasta

Spiazzo Caffe is located at
33 W Portal Ave
San Francisco, CA
415-664-9511
Add Spiazzo Caffe to Facebook

Do you own or manage this restaurant?
and update or enhance this page with photos, menus and more information!